WebJul 31, 2024 · The reason the Presbyterian church lists “the proclamation of the gospel for the salvation of humankind” as the first “great end” of the church is that it is our identity too. We are the redeemed of the Lord. We have experienced the salvation of God, and it has fundamentally changed who we are. WebProminent Presbyterian pastors and leaders address each of the Great Ends of the Church in sermons that both challenge and uplift readers. For decades the Great Ends of the Church, a historic listing of ways Presbyterians have understood the role of the church, has helped to establish church directions in mission and ministry. sharry mann ageWebTheology. Some of the principles articulated by John Calvin are still at the core of Presbyterian beliefs. Among these are the sovereignty of God, the authority of Scripture, justification by grace through faith and the priesthood of all believers.
